Job Title: Norwich Co-Pilot (Air Ambulance Co-Pilot for Norwich)
Location: Norwich, UK - Onsite
Compensation: £51,077.00
Role Type: 40 Hours, 4 on 4 off shift pattern
Role ID: SF: 50262

Essential experience
Hold an EASA ATPL (H) or CPL(H) with IR
500 hours minimum total helicopter experience.
Fluent English, Driving License, Passport, Right to Work in the UK.
Obtain or have the ability to obtain basic clearance
